Sind Stapeldatenstrukturen?

Inhaltsverzeichnis:

Sind Stapeldatenstrukturen?
Sind Stapeldatenstrukturen?

Video: Sind Stapeldatenstrukturen?

Video: Sind Stapeldatenstrukturen?
Video: Stack - Dynamische Datenstrukturen 6 2024, März
Anonim

Stack ist eine lineare Datenstruktur, die einer bestimmten Reihenfolge folgt, in der die Operationen ausgeführt werden. Die Reihenfolge kann LIFO (Last In First Out) oder FILO (First In Last Out) sein. Es gibt viele reale Beispiele für einen Stack.

Ist Stack eine Datenstruktur oder ADT?

Ein Stapel ist ein abstrakter Datentyp (ADT), der in den meisten Programmiersprachen verwendet wird. … Diese Funktion macht es zu einer LIFO-Datenstruktur. LIFO steht für Last-in-first-out.

Ist Stack eine sequentielle Datenstruktur?

Stacks und Queues sind sehr einfache ADTs mit sehr einfachen Methoden - und deshalb können wir diese ADTs so implementieren, dass die Methoden alle in O(1)-Zeit laufen. In diesem Abschnitt ist unser mathematisches Modell der Daten eine lineare Folge von Elementen. … Der Rang eines Elements e in einer Folge S ist die Anzahl der Elemente vor e in S.

Ist der Stack eine dynamische Datenstruktur?

Stacks sind dynamische Datenstrukturen, die dem Last In First Out (LIFO)-Prinzip folgen. Das letzte Element, das in einen Stapel eingefügt wird, ist das erste, das daraus gelöscht wird. Sie haben zum Beispiel einen Stapel Tabletts auf einem Tisch.

Ist der Stapel eine primitive Datenstruktur?

Beispiele für nicht-primitiv Datenstrukturen sind Array, Strukturen, Vereinigung, verkettete Liste, Stapel, Warteschlange, Baum, Graph usw.

Empfohlen: